KernelCare چیست و چرا مهم است؟
KernelCare چیست و چرا مهم است؟
این مقاله تمام آنچه را که باید در مورد Kernelcare بدانید توضیح می دهد.
اما قبل از مطالعه در مورد Kernelcare ، اجازه دهید یک نگاهی به هسته لینوکس بیندازیم.
این به شما در درک بهتر KernelCare کمک می کند.
هسته لینوکس قسمت اصلی سیستم عامل لینوکس است. این در حافظه ساکن است و CPU را وادار می کند که چه کاری انجام دهد.
اکنون بیایید با موضوع امروز شروع کنیم که Kernelcare است. و اگر مدیر سیستم هستید ، این مقاله می خواهد اطلاعات ارزشمندی را برای شما ارائه دهد.
Kernelcare چیست؟
Kernelcare یک سرویس پچ است که به روزرسانی های امنیتی زنده را برای هسته های لینوکس ، کتابخانه های مشترک و دستگاه های تعبیه شده ارائه می دهد.
همچنین پچ های امنیتی را در داخل هسته لینوکس بدون ایجاد وقفه در سرویس یا هرگونه خرابی ایجاد می کند.
پس از نصب KernelCare روی سرور ، به روزرسانی های امنیتی به طور خودکار هر 4 ساعت روی سرور اعمال می شوند.
این پچ امنیتی نیاز به راه اندازی مجدد سرور شما پس از بروزرسانی ها را رد می کند.
این یک محصول تجاری و تحت لایسنس GNU GPL نسخه 2 است.
Cloud Linux ، Inc این محصول را توسعه داده است. اولین نسخه بتا KernelCare در مارس 2014 منتشر شد و راه اندازی تجاری آن در ماه مه 2014 بود.
از آن زمان آنها ادغام های مختلفی را برای ابزارهای اتوماسیون ، اسکنرهای آسیب پذیری و سایر موارد اضافه کرده اند.
سیستم عامل های پشتیبانی شده توسط Kernelcare شامل CentOS/RHEL 5 ، 6 ، 7 ؛ Cloud Linux 5 ، 6 ؛ OpenVZ ، PCS ، Virtuozzo ، Debian 6 ، 7 ؛ و اوبونتو 14.04 هستند.
آیا Kernelcare مهم است؟
آیا تعجب می کنید که آیا KernelCare برای شما مهم است یا خیر؟
با نصب آخرین پچ های امنیتی هسته ، شما قادر به حداقل رساندن خطرات احتمالی هستید.
وقتی سعی می کنید هسته لینوکس را به صورت دستی به روز کنید ، ممکن است ساعت ها طول بکشد. جدا از خرابی سرور ، این می تواند یک کار استرس زا برای مدیر سیستم و
همچنین برای مشتری باشد.
پس از به روزرسانی هسته ، سرور به راه اندازی مجدد نیاز دارد. این کار معمولاً در ساعات کار خارج از اوج انجام می شود. و این باعث استرس اضافی می شود.
با این حال ، نادیده گرفتن راه اندازی مجدد سرور می تواند باعث ایجاد مشکلات امنیتی زیادی شود.
دیده می شود که ، حتی پس از راه اندازی مجدد ، سرور مشکلات را تجربه می کند و به راحتی بازگردانده نمی شود.
رفع چنین مواردی مشکلی برای سرپرستان سیستم است. غالباً مدیر سیستم باید تمام به روزرسانی های کاربردی را به عقب برگرداند تا سرور به سرعت افزایش یابد.
با استفاده از KernelCare ، می توانید از چنین مواردی جلوگیری کنید.
Kernelcare چگونه کار می کند؟
KernelCare باعث از بین رفتن عدم رعایت و خدمات ناشی از راه اندازی مجدد سیستم می شود.
KernelCare agent در سرور شما ساکن است. به طور دوره ای به روزرسانی های جدید را بررسی می کند.
در صورت یافتن هر چیزی ، agent آن را بارگیری می کند و آنها را در هسته در حال اجرا اعمال می کند.
یک پچ Kernelcare را می توان به عنوان یک قطعه کد تعریف کرد که برای جایگزینی کد buggy در هسته استفاده می شود.
ماژول Kernelcare از پچ ها استفاده می کند. این پچ ها را بارگیری می کند ، جابجایی ها را تنظیم می کند و مسیر اجرا را از کد اولیه به بلوک های کد اصلاح شده تغییر می دهد.
این کد تضمین می کند که Patch KernelCare با خیال راحت اعمال می شود تا CPU هنگام تغییر به نسخه به روز شده ، کد اولیه را اجرا نکند.
مزایای استفاده از KernelCare
در زیر 5 ویژگی برتر KernelCare آمده که با درک این ویژگی ها به این مرحله خواهید رسید که هرگز نمی خواهید KernelCare را از دست بدهید.
آخرین ارتقاء امنیت و ثبات
با استفاده از CernelCare ، نیازی به به روزرسانی دستی نیست. این باعث مدیریت در زمان می شود.
نصب سریع
به راحتی می توانید KernelCare را نصب کنید. و برای انجام این کار نیازی به راه اندازی مجدد سرور ندارید. با دادن دستورات از خط فرمان ، نصب را می توان انجام داد.
بدون تأثیر عملکرد
Cernelcare پچ ها را از طریق یک ماژول هسته بار می کند. از آنجا که پچ ها نانو ثانیه را به کار می گیرند ، بر عملکرد سیستم شما تأثیر نمی گذارد.
Roll Patch سریع
هر زمان که تیم KernelCare هرگونه آسیب پذیری امنیتی را که بر هر یک از هسته های پشتیبانی شده تأثیر می گذارد ، پیدا می کند ، بلافاصله آنها یک تکه جدید را برای از بین بردن
تأثیر آن تهیه می کنند.
امکان برگشت تغییرات
آیا می خواهید تغییرات را برگردانید؟ با استفاده از KernelCare ، می توانید این کار را نیز انجام دهید. اجرای یک دستور ویژه به شما امکان می دهد تمام تغییرات اعمال شده را به عقب
برگردانید.
نتیجه
از طریق این مقاله ، شما فهمیدید که Kernelcare چیست ، KernelCare چقدر مهم است ، چگونه کار می کند و چه مزایای دارد.
Kernelcare محصولی خوب برای مدیران سیستم است زیرا کار آنها را آسان تر می کند.
اگر در مورد استفاده از KernelCare حدس می زنید ، من مطمئن هستم که خواندن این مقاله به شما در پاک کردن شک و تردید کمک می کند.
دوره های آموزشی پیشنهادی:
دوره آموزشی صفر تا 100 راه اندازی خدمات هاستینگ
پک آموزشی ورود به دنیای لینوکس Linux Essentials
دوره آموزشی +Linux یا LPIC 1 – Exam 101
# KernelCare چیست # KernelCare چیست
دیدگاهتان را بنویسید
برای نوشتن دیدگاه باید وارد بشوید.